Yes, its crappy..... Since the CPU has just 16 lanes of PCIE (never change for donkey years), if all 16 are allocated to graphics, the rest needs to go through the chipset. No doubt Intel is nice to include up to 24 lanes. Nice!!

https://www.tomshardware.com/news/intel-z490-comet_lake_s-motherboards

But here is the problem... See that DMI 3.0 link? Its just as fast as PCIE 3.0 4X....... just 4GB/s. Your nvme, NIC, SATA, USB etc etc... all uses that 4GB/s. Now you can see where the bottleneck is.

Of course, you can reduce the GPU to 8x and have 8 lanes for nvme. But its stupid for a flagship cpu, chipset and board (budget ones are fine).


OK, I know AMD also sucks in their link. but at least the x570 has PCIE 4.0 x4. thats 8GB/s. Then AMD has more PCIE lanes on their CPU! So, we could have full 16 lanes for GPU and 8 more for others. Then they even have USB that goes to the CPU. Minimise all I/O bottlenecks.

This platform reminds me of the Prescott Pentium 4 era where they pushed the netburst architecture to its limit no matter temps or TDP.

Of course, the next thing they came up was Conroe and that went in the right direction. We'll see.

Intel is employing exactly the same tactic here. However I am not sure Intel can turn around quickly this time, like they did previously. Conroe was a power efficient architecture, couple with Intel’s lead in fab then, gave them a significant advantage over competition. Now Intel have lost the fab advantage, so they can only rely on significant architecture improvements to turn them around in terms of performance and power efficiency.

10th Gen to me is just an overclocked 9th Gen with Intel Turbo Boost 3.0 and TVB allowing 5.3Ghz. Do take note it is only momentarily not perpetual 5.3Ghz on all cores but 2 best cores in your CPU.

Untill there is a new architecture or new fabrication process, Intel is pretty much stagnant at this point and especially since Skylake. The only plus point on the 10th Gen is that it has reduced in price against what they charge but still no where near AMD for price. Not to forget that the Intel needs a cooler and the one included is not sufficient at all to barely cool the 14nm+++++++++ runs HOT.

I think Intel is adamant about moving to 10nm and below because they may not be able to have the clockspeed advantage they are currently at now. I think that could be the main reason why they stay on 14nm and just try to have better yields so as to have them more overclocked out of the box. It does not make sense because it just goes to show then even if Intel could only hit 4.2Ghz for example at 10nm but have a significant increase in IPC, most would think it is slower than the previous generation. IPC gains since Skylake is virtually marginal and negligible at best.

One thing fun to play on the Intel Platform is memory over-clocks. They really can run high frequency tightened and yield a significant increase in 0.1% lows in gaming. But with B-die now out of production, the Z490 may seem far less enticing at this point.
